Heads up, support folks: we've changed several defaults in the TideGlance widget after the Saltmere pilot feedback. The widget now refreshes tide predictions every 30 minutes instead of hourly, defaults to the user's nearest station rather than Port Ashen, and shows a 48-hour window instead of 24. Customers who customized these before 3.2 keep their settings; everyone else gets the new behavior automatically. If someone asks what they're running, compare their setup against the new default configuration values below.

deployment values, yadug-bawif:
[framir]
team = pelox
access_code = ac_a38ab2
owner = tamion.julael
host = framir.tolvaqlabs.test
port = 11211
peer = tammir.zemvargrid.local
salt = 2215ef03
pin = 1541

Welcome to the SpokeShift support rotation!

SpokeShift is our rebalancing tool that tells depot crews which bike docks to top up or drain each morning. Riders sometimes report "empty station" even when the plan shows bikes en route — check the crew's task status before assuming a bug. If a station is flagged offline, the planner skips it entirely, which confuses people. The dashboard and common-issues guide live on the internal page here:

runbook for tafof-yawif: https://confluence.tolvaqsys.internal/display/display/browse/pages/7be3

Finance Review — Western Region

Branch managers: solid quarter overall. Halder branch beat target by 9%, mostly on Fernlight renewals; Cresswick lagged on new logos again. Margins held despite the freight bump. We'll dig into Cresswick's pipeline next week. One strategic item couldn't go in the main deck, so it's appended just below.

confidential, kagep-kahof: Druokax Systems plans to lower the Ulaath list price by 53 percent in March.